Qu'est-ce que l'espace de noms dans Kafka ?

Développeur: La Fondation du logiciel Apache

À ce sujet, qu'est-ce que __ Consumer_offsets dans Kafka ?

__consumer_offsets est utilisé pour stocker des informations sur les décalages validés pour chaque sujet : partition par groupe de consommateurs (groupID). Il s'agit d'un sujet compacté, de sorte que les données seront périodiquement compressées et que seules les dernières informations sur les décalages seront disponibles.

De plus, qu'est-ce que le chemin chroot dans l'outil Kafka ? Zookeeper vous permet également d'ajouter un " chrooter " chemin qui fera tout kafka les données de ce cluster apparaissent sous un chemin . C'est une façon de configurer plusieurs Kafka clusters ou d'autres applications sur le même cluster zookeeper.

Aussi, comment fonctionne Kafka ?

Démarrage rapide

  1. Étape 1 : Téléchargez le code.
  2. Étape 2 : Démarrez le serveur.
  3. Étape 3 : Créez un sujet.
  4. Étape 4 : Envoyez des messages.
  5. Étape 5 : Démarrez un consommateur.
  6. Étape 6 : Configuration d'un cluster multi-courtiers.
  7. Étape 7 : Utilisez Kafka Connect pour importer/exporter des données.
  8. Étape 8 : Utilisez Kafka Streams pour traiter les données.

Qu'est-ce que Kafka sous Linux ?

Kafka se compose d'enregistrements, de rubriques, de consommateurs, de producteurs, de courtiers, de journaux, de partitions et de clusters. le Kafka L'API Producer est utilisée pour produire des flux d'enregistrements de données. le Kafka L'API consommateur est utilisée pour consommer un flux d'enregistrements à partir de Kafka . Un courtier est un Kafka serveur qui s'exécute dans un Kafka groupe.

Comment fonctionne la compensation Kafka ?

le le décalage est un nombre entier simple qui est utilisé par Kafka pour maintenir la position actuelle d'un consommateur. C'est ça. Le courant le décalage est un pointeur vers le dernier enregistrement qui Kafka a déjà envoyé à un consommateur dans le sondage le plus récent. Ainsi, le consommateur n'obtient pas deux fois le même enregistrement à cause du courant décalage .

Voir aussi :  L'edamame séché est-il bon pour vous ?

Où Kafka compense-t-il ?

Décalage Espace de rangement - Kafka Décalages dans Kafka sont stockés sous forme de messages dans un sujet séparé nommé '__consumer_offsets' . Chaque consommateur valide un message dans le sujet à intervalles réguliers.

Qu'est-ce que la technologie Kafka ?

apache Kafka est une plate-forme logicielle de traitement de flux open source développée par LinkedIn et offerte à Apache Software Foundation, écrite en Scala et Java. Le projet vise à fournir une plate-forme unifiée, à haut débit et à faible latence pour la gestion des flux de données en temps réel.

Comment Kafka détermine-t-il la compensation des consommateurs ?

Afin de visualiser décalages sur un site sécurisé Kafka grappe, le consommateur L'outil -groups doit être exécuté avec l'option command-config. Cette option spécifie le fichier de propriétés qui contient les configurations nécessaires pour exécuter l'outil sur un cluster sécurisé.

Qu'est-ce qu'un client Kafka ?

La première partie d'Apache Kafka pour les débutants explique ce que Kafka est - un système de messagerie durable basé sur la publication et l'abonnement qui échange des données entre les processus, les applications et les serveurs. Il vous donnera une brève compréhension de la messagerie et des journaux distribués, et des concepts importants seront définis.

Quel concept de Kafka aide à mettre à l'échelle le traitement et le multi-abonnement ?

Comme pour publier- s'abonner , Kafka permet de diffuser des messages à plusieurs groupes de consommateurs. L'avantage de de Kafka modèle est que chaque sujet a ces deux propriétés - il peut traitement à l'échelle et est aussi multi - abonné — il n'est pas nécessaire de choisir l'un ou l'autre.

Qu'est-ce que le décalage de sujet Kafka ?

Kafka continuellement ajouté aux partitions en utilisant la partition comme journal de validation structuré. Les enregistrements dans les partitions se voient attribuer un numéro d'identification séquentiel appelé le décalage . le décalage identifie chaque emplacement d'enregistrement dans la partition. Sujet les partitions permettent Kafka log à l'échelle au-delà d'une taille qui tiendra sur un seul serveur.

Voir aussi :  Que sont les graminées adventices ?

Quelle est la durée de conservation par défaut d'un sujet Kafka ?

168 heures

Combien de temps faut-il pour apprendre Kafka ?

Ré: Apprentissage apache Kafka pour Débutant Il vous permettra de démarrer très rapidement et vous permettra apprendre sur les concepts les plus importants en moins de deux heures. Au total, il y a 4 heures de contenu !

Pourquoi utiliser Kafka ?

Kafka est une plateforme de streaming distribué qui est utilisé pour publier et s'abonner à des flux d'enregistrements. Kafka est utilisé pour le stockage tolérant aux pannes. Kafka est utilisé pour découpler les flux de données. Kafka est utilisé pour diffuser des données dans des lacs de données, des applications et des systèmes d'analyse de flux en temps réel.

Kafka peut-il fonctionner sans ZooKeeper ?

Comme l'ont expliqué d'autres, Kafka (même dans la version la plus récente) volonté ne pas travailler sans Zookeeper . Kafka les usages Gardien de zoo pour ce qui suit : Élection d'un contrôleur. Le contrôleur est l'un des courtiers et est responsable du maintien de la relation leader/suiveur pour toutes les partitions.

Kafka est-il un middleware ?

est apache kafka un middleware entre la base de données et l'application ? Les bases de données modernes sont déjà rapides donc en utilisant kafka entre l'application et les bases de données n'apportera pas beaucoup d'avantages. Vous pouvez l'utiliser parmi différentes applications dépendantes. Désormais, les applications dépendent de kafka seulement pas entre eux.

Kafka est-il facile à apprendre ?

Le meilleur moyen de apprendre sur Kafka est d'avoir une formation structurée. Mais avant de suivre une formation en ligne, passez par là pour avoir un aperçu de la technologie et des principes fondamentaux. apache Kafka est un système de messagerie distribué qui vous permet de publier et de vous abonner à des flux d'enregistrements.

Voir aussi :  Où se produit l'activité tectonique ?

Kafka est-il une base de données ?

Explorons une question litigieuse : est-ce Kafka une base de données ? À certains égards, oui : il écrit tout sur le disque et réplique les données sur plusieurs machines pour garantir leur durabilité. Autrement dit, non : il n'a pas de modèle de données, pas d'index, pas de moyen d'interroger les données sauf en s'abonnant aux messages d'un sujet.

Comment me connecter à Kafka ?

Approcher

  1. Installez une instance de serveur Kafka localement à des fins d'évaluation.
  2. Exécutez le serveur Kafka et créez un nouveau sujet.
  3. Configurez l'Atom local avec les bibliothèques clientes Kafka.
  4. Créez un processus d'intégration AtomSphere pour publier des messages dans la rubrique Kafka via des scripts personnalisés Groovy.

Java est-il requis pour Kafka ?

Pour apprendre les concepts de base : Non, vous ne le faites pas besoin de Java lire Kafka documentation et utilisez leur utilitaire CLI pour vous familiariser. Mais si vous voulez comprendre tous les concepts de Kafka en expérimentant alors peut être Java est obligatoire car si vous effectuez une recherche, la plupart des exemples que vous pourrez trouver sur Internet se trouveront dans Java .

Comment tester un consommateur Kafka ?

1 réponse

  1. Vous devez démarrer zookeeper et kafka par programmation pour les tests d'intégration.
  2. émettre des événements à diffuser en utilisant KafkaProducer.
  3. Consommez ensuite avec votre consommateur pour tester et vérifier son fonctionnement.
Cliquez pour évaluer cet article !
[Total: Moyenne : ]

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ée.